Neeraj Chopra is set to return to the Commonwealth Games after 8 years, since winning the title at the Gold Coast 2018.
He will start his campaign with the qualification round alongside two other Indians, Rohit Yadav and Yashvir Singh, at 2:55 PM IST.
The automatic qualification mark is set at 84m, from which 12 athletes will qualify in the 18-man qualifying field.
The field is packed with world-class javelin throwers, including reigning Olympic champion Arshad Nadeem (PAK), reigning world champion Keshorn Walcott (T&T), two-time world champion Anderson Peters (GRN), Julius Yego (KEN), and world lead Rumesh Pathirage (SRI).
